Transaction 21f3e4035f3def986a74787813d2476414bb1cd12de051669cf6479047e11d17

1 Input
2 Outputs
  • 21f3e4035f3def986a74787813d2476414bb1cd12de051669cf6479047e11d17:0
  • value  22314455
    address  18fiYrWdExf6hMECCwj2FKhLk8X3upCQ3E
  • 21f3e4035f3def986a74787813d2476414bb1cd12de051669cf6479047e11d17:1
  • value  163877504
    address  bc1quw8r48rluseswp82znfgyyt76adyfrf73r2keq